Overview Valicet M Kid 2.5mg/5mg Tablet DT

Pediatric allergy relief, Valicet M Kid 2.5mg/5mg Tablet DT, effectively manages common allergy symptoms in children, including nasal discharge, sneezing fits, itching, inflammation, nasal congestion, and teary eyes. It also aids in asthma and skin allergy management. Administer this medication to your child at the prescribed dosage and frequency, either before or after meals. For asthma control, the optimal time is in the evening or two hours prior to exercise. For allergies, morning or evening administration is suitable, depending on symptom onset; for children with both asthma and allergies, evening dosing is preferred. If vomiting occurs within 30 minutes, repeat the dose; however, omit if the next dose is due. Significant symptom relief is usually observed after several doses; nevertheless, complete the full course for optimal results. Discontinuing treatment prematurely may exacerbate the condition. Minor, transient side effects such as n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, dizziness, dry mouth, rash, and headache may occur, typically resolving with continued use. Persistent or troublesome side effects necessitate immediate consultation with your child's physician. Inform your child's doctor about all current medications and provide a complete medical history, encompassing previous allergies, cardiovascular issues, hematological disorders, vascular problems, congenital anomalies, airway obstructions, pulmonary abnormalities, dermatological conditions, hepatic impairment, and renal dysfunction. This comprehensive information is essential for accurate dosage adjustments and optimal treatment planning.

How Valicet M Kid 2.5mg/5mg Tablet DT works:

Valicet M Kid 2.5mg/5mg Disintegrating Tablets combine levocetirizine and montelukast to alleviate allergic symptoms such as sneezing and rhinorrhea. Levocetirizine, an antihistamine, counteracts histamine, a mediator of allergic responses causing nasal discharge, lacrimation, and sneezing. Montelukast, a leukotriene receptor antagonist, inhibits the action of leukotrienes, inflammatory mediators, thereby lessening airway and nasal inflammation and improving symptoms.

What if you forget to take Valicet M Kid 2.5mg/5mg Tablet DT :

Remain calm. Unless otherwise directed by your pediatrician, administer the missed dose immediately upon recollection. However, omit the missed dose if the next scheduled dose is imminent. Avoid doubling the dose to compensate, and adhere to the recommended medication schedule.

FAQs on Valicet M Kid 2.5mg/5mg Tablet DT

Avoid combining cough and allergy medications; they often share active ingredients, leading to accidental overdose and potentially severe side effects.
Never adjust your child's medication dosage without their doctor's guidance. Increasing the dose can lead to side effects such as drowsiness and depression, while decreasing or abruptly stopping it may cause symptoms to return with greater intensity.
Store Valicet M Kid 2.5mg/5mg DT tablets at room temperature, in a dry place, protected from heat and light. Keep out of children's reach and sight.
Valicet M Kid 2.5mg/5mg Tablet DT may cause mild drowsiness in your child. Do not use this medication to make your child sleep, as this could conceal an undiagnosed sleep problem such as insomnia.
Before giving your child Valicet M Kid 2.5mg/5mg Tablet DT, consult their doctor. This medication may cause drowsiness, dizziness, and reduced performance, so a doctor's advice is essential.
Abruptly stopping Valicet M Kid 2.5mg/5mg Tablet DT after long-term use may cause symptoms to return. Your child's doctor should supervise any gradual discontinuation of this medication.
Valicet M Kid 2.5mg/5mg Tablet DT has been linked in some studies to mood disturbances, including depression, anxiety, hallucinations, suicidal thoughts, tremors, and movement control difficulties. Always consult your child's doctor before administering any medication.
Valicet M Kid 2.5mg/5mg DT tablets are for asthma attack prevention only. Do not use them to treat an attack in progress. Use your child's rescue inhaler for ongoing asthma attacks.
